  • The Tecsun PL-660 AM FM LW Shortwave SSB AIR Band Portable Radio is brought back out after three years! How well does it do on the Evening MW band? Watch to find out :) I employ the Terk Advantage Passive Loop to further improve reception.

    Overall, the 660 is still a viable purchase in 2022 compared to others in the category. No Mute On Tuning is Excellent, allowing you to get on frequency fast. The receiver shines on Shortwave, and the Medium Wave Bands.
